    I could tell you more, but it is related to scaling each font scale has a different icon layout. There is one for 100%, 125%, and 150%. The system gets confused. Latest I noticed, every time I turned off the screen and turned it on again the fonts would all be realigned. Also (unlike earlier experience) the auto arrange flag would be re-turned on. My solution (which you won't like) was to replace everything on the desktop with a shortcut. You can create normal shortcuts (including recycle) for everything, these are sortable. Add a sequence number and leave auto arrange on. Windows can't **** this up, and if it does, just resort. A pain in the arse, but my desktop is useable now.

    Here's the skinny...
    After valued research that goes back to 2009.
    Microsoft has no intention to fix this because they've known about it since then.
    Monitors through the HDMI "PORT" are treated as devices as in Display Device.
    When it's turned off there is no more device which forces Windows to revert back to default state which is 800x600 and that means your icons and open windows/programs will jump to the left unless the window itself has an assigned save position value which it will go back to after the resize occurs.

    There is a device some ass sells which is nothing more than an HDMI Angle adapter that he bought for a couple bucks, opens it up and changes one wire then sells it for $20.

    It disables the autodetect which for some reason neither NVidia or Microsoft will have a manual disable in their software.
    ATI cards has a registry value that you can change that will work.
